Cinnamon Peach Breakfast Bread
A delicious and light Breakfast Bread that is welcome at breakfast, brunch, and dessert. In fact, this makes a welcome snack anytime, too.
Prep Time 10 minutes mins
Cook Time 1 hour hr 15 minutes mins
Course Bread, Breakfast, Dessert, Snack
Cuisine American
Servings 16 slices
Calories 166 kcal
- 1 ripe banana peeled and mashed
- 3/4 cup applesauce unsweetened
- 1 cup Swerve sugar replacer
- 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
- 1/2 cup coconut oil vegan yogurt works well, too!
- 2 cups peaches peeled, pitted, and diced small
- 3 cups wheat flour white wheat works well for a whole-grain option
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 4 teaspoons cinnamon
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F ( 176 degrees C). Grease 2 bread loaf pan. Alternatively, line with parchment paper.
In a large bowl, blend the banana, applesauce, sugar, oil, and vanilla.
Add the fl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t, and cinnamon; mix just to combine.
Stir in the peaches.
Pour the batter halfway into the prepared bread pans.
Place them into the preheated oven and bake for about an hour. Check to see if it’s fully baked by placing a toothpick or fork into the middle of the loaf, if it comes out clean, it’s finished. If it has batter on it, bake for another 15 minutes.
